The chief digital, data, and analytics officer of NAB will resign

Angela Mentis, NAB’s Group Chief Digital, Data, and Analytics Officer, is set to retire at the beginning of November. The bank made this announcement in an ASX filing [pdf] and revealed that Les Matheson, the current Group Chief Operating Officer, will assume responsibility for the digital and data portfolios.

NAB’s CEO, Ross McEwan, praised Mentis for her customer-centric approach and outstanding results throughout her career. He expressed understanding and acceptance of her decision to retire from full-time executive roles to spend more time with her family.

Mentis took on the role of Group Chief Digital, Data, and Analytics Officer in October 2021. She has a long history with NAB and its divisions since 2006, as well as experience with other prominent financial institutions like Westpac, BT Financial, Citibank, and Macquarie Bank.

In addition to overseeing the digital, data, and analytics division, Les Matheson will also be responsible for group marketing, product improvement, and governance at NAB’s digital-only bank, ubank. Pending regulatory approvals, Matheson will assume his new role on November 1.
